How to Watch on ESPN and Disney Platforms

ESPN carries the national broadcast and is the primary home for Monday Night Football. You can watch through cable, satellite, or streaming services that include ESPN in their lineup.

If you already have a subscription to a provider like Y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, or DirecTV Stream, logging in to the ESPN app or website typically grants instant access to the game. This method mirrors the experience of watching on traditional television with full live controls.

Streaming Options for Cord-Cutters

For cord-cutters, ESPN+ provides out-of-market access to Monday Night Football when the game is not nationally televised, subject to blackout rules. You do not need a traditional TV package to use ESPN+, but this service does not carry the national ESPN broadcast of MNF.

Services such as Hulu + Live TV, YouTube TV, and FuboTV include ESPN in their channel lineups and offer free trials that can align with early season games. These platforms deliver a familiar TV interface with cloud DVR so you can record and watch later if needed.

Over-the-Air and Local Broadcast Alternatives

In some markets, Monday Night Football appears on ABC stations, giving you the option to use an antenna and stream for free. Check your local ABC affiliate and its schedule, because not all games are assigned to the local network.

Using the ABC app or trusted free streaming services with your location and ZIP code allows you to catch the game without paying for a premium streaming subscription. Keep in mind that blackouts may still apply based on your market and local rights.

Mobile Apps and On-the-Go Viewing

The ESPN App offers one of the most flexible ways to follow the action, whether you are traveling or away from your main television. With a valid TV login, the app unlocks the same live stream you would watch at home, plus real-time scores and updates.

For subscribers of streaming TV services, using their corresponding app (such as YouTube TV or Hulu) on phones and tablets ensures you do not miss key plays. Many apps support picture-in-picture and background audio so you can multitask during the game.

FAQ

Reader questions

Can I watch Monday Night Football for free with an antenna and local channels?

Yes, in markets where the game is carried by ABC, you can use an antenna and a free streaming service that carries local ABC to view the game at no extra cost.

Is ESPN+ enough to watch every Monday Night Football game?

No, ESPN+ only shows out-of-market games and does not carry the national ESPN broadcast; you will still need a TV subscription or a streaming service with ESPN for the main telecast.

Do I need a full cable package to stream Monday Night Football?

Not necessarily. Many standalone streaming services such as Y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, and FuboTV provide ESPN without requiring a traditional cable plan.

What happens if my game is blacked out in my area?

Blackouts restrict local broadcasts, but you may still watch the game through your TV provider’s authenticated streaming app or via ESPN+ when the rules allow.
